Whereas competing central lighting systems require home runs to a single central cabinet, modular Omni-Bus components can be located where needed to save wiring and installation costs.
OmniBus architecture includes low cost splitters and T-connections for ease of installation and expandability. OmniBus network can be star, hub and spoke, daisy chain or a combination. T-connections allow a spur to be added to any network cable. An OmniBus Network can co-exist and interact with OmniBus Wireless products in the same installation.
HAI Omni-Bus is easy to use and includes free setup software. Diagnostic LED's on the devices help with installation of up to 256 nodes on the network. Standard Category 5 UTP (Unshielded Twisted Pair) data cable is used between the devices and features up to 1000m OmniBus cable length.
Power modules feed power to dimmer or non-dimming switches. Each switch wires to a DIN rail module. The power for the circuit also goes to these DIN rail modules, thus switches are not directly wired to lights but rather to the modules controlling the lights. As with third-party solutions, Omni-Bus lighting works by a low voltage wire from the hardwired switch to the dimmer DIN rail module, but with the distinctive advantage of being an HAI product.
OmniBus components assure properly terminated data cable for high speed data bus – no jumpers to set. The OmniBus network is powered by a low supply voltage (24VDC) power supply. Each module is optically isolated from the mains supply side, making modules safer for users, installers. Modules are more resistant to electrical surges and lightning.
Integrating with an HAI Home Control System
Omni-Bus Products work as stand-alone or with an HAI Home Control System.
An HAI home control system has the ability to change your light settings by the
time of day, a set schedule, by the triggering of events (including motion), via a telephone call,
Touchscreen, Smartphone, or by a computer connected to the Internet. Interface to HAI Controllers is via Ethernet port – no serial connection is needed.
